    Tuko.co.ke is a Kenyan news website owned by Legit that covers celebrity, entertainment, and political news in English and Swahili. It is one of the most popular news websites in Kenya, with over 1.7 million users and 44th most-visited website in February 2024.

    Irine Julia Majale who is known professionally as Julia Majale is a Kenyan journalist, editor and the managing director of Tuko.co.ke. [1] In 2021 she made the list of Top 25 Women in Digital at the SOMA Awards. [2] She is a board member of the Women Human Rights Defender's Hub powered by Kenya National Commission on Human Rights.     Yvonne Okwara is a Kenyan journalist who works for Citizen TV. She has a BSc in microbiology and a Bloomberg/Africa Leadership Initiative Media fellowship.

    Tokay gecko (Gekko gecko) is a large, nocturnal, arboreal gecko native to Asia and some Pacific Islands. It is also known as tuko in the Philippines and Vietnam, and its mating call is a loud croak that can sound like "tokay".

    George Wajackoyah is a Kenyan lawyer, educator and politician who ran for president in 2022 under the Roots Party. He supports legalizing bhang, snake farming and the 'Shot in State House' theory of Robert Ouko's murder.

    Soipan Tuya is a Kenyan politician and the first Maasai woman to be in the Cabinet of Kenya. She was appointed as Cabinet secretary for Environment, Climate Change and Forestry in 2023, but was later reassigned to Defence.
